Abstract

Background: Cataract is a serious problem in the world because it is the biggest cause of blindness in the world. Cataract healing can only be done with operative measures, one of them is phacoemulsification. The phacoemulsification technique is the latest operative technique for cataract healing but both conventional techniques or phacoemulsification techniques can cause a decrease in tear secretion after cataract surgery. The reduction in tear secretion can be evaluated using the Schirmer I test. In this study an analysis of differences in tear secretion before and after phacoemulsification surgery.Aims: Knowing, comparing, and analyzing the differences in tear secretion before and after phacoemulsification surgery using the Schirmer I test.Methods: 22 cataract eyes consisting of 15 patients who will undergo phacoemulsification surgery were collected by consecutive sampling at the Sultan Agung Eye Center, Sultan Agung Hospital, Semarang from August to September 2019, examined using the Schirmer I test. After the data was collected, data analyzed with Wilcoxon rank test.Results: A total of 15 cataract patients consisting of 10 female patients and 5 male patients with a total of 22 eye samples. The average tear secretion before and after phacoemulsification surgery was 12.77 ± 2.74 mm and 11.00 ± 1.95 mm. Data were tested with the Wilcoxon rank test, p = 0,000 (p <0.05) which showed a difference in average tear secretion before and after phacoemulsification.Conclusion: There are differences in tear secretion before and after phacoemulsification surgery.

Abstract

Background: Myopia is one of the visual disorders that has a high prevalence in the world. Based on the severity degree, myopia is divided into three criteria, namely mild, moderate and severe. Severe-degree myopia patients are more likely to suffer from certain eye diseases, especially those associated with the retina, such as retinal detachment.Objective: To analyze the relationship between the degree of myopia and the incidence of retinal detachment.Methods: This research is an observational analytical with cross-sectional approach. The research data was obtained using consecutive sampling from the medical records of myopia patients in Diponegoro National Hospital during 2015-2020. Research subjects used in this research were 70 patients who fulfill the inclusion and not the exclusion criteria. The data were analyzed using Chi Square test.  Results: The prevalence of retinal detachment is dominated by the age group of 51-60 years old (18.6%), male (35.7%) and a severe degree of myopia (34.3%). The results of the Chi Square test show that there is a significant relationship between the severity degree of myopia and the incidence of retinal detachment.Conclusion: There is a significant relationship between the degree of myopia and the incidence of retinal detachment.
The Effect of Ethanolic Extract of Moringa oleifera Leaves on the Macrophage Count and VEGF Expression on Wistar Rats with Burn Wound Agnes Stella Valentina; Najatullah; Trilaksana Nugroho; Neni Susilaningsih

Abstract

Background: One modality type of burn wound therapy is topical silver sulfadiazine. Recently, research about topical herb medicine has grown. Moringa oleifera (MO) is a kind of herb plant that has an anti-inflammation effect and has an influence on angiogenesis, so it tends to faster burn wound healing. This study aimed to prove the effect of ethanolic extract of Moringa oleifera leaves on the macrophage count and VEGF expression in Wistar rats with burn wounds. Methods: The research design that was used is "Randomized post-test with a control group." The study population used 24 male Wistar rats that were induced burn wounds and randomly divided into 4 groups which were given medicine topically once daily for 7 days. Treatment groups included: I (MO leaves extract 10%), II (SSD + MO leaves extract 10%), III (SSD), dan IV (pure vehiculum). Exudation was assessed macroscopically, while PMN and macrophage amount were assessed microscopically with Hematoxylin-Eosin. Data were analyzed and processed using hypothesis test One Way ANOVA – Post Hoc Bonferroni, Kruskal Wallis – Mann Whitney, and correlation test Spearman and Pearson with SPSS 25.0 program. Results: Significant difference obtained in macrophage amount between II group and IV group (p 0,000). There was no significant difference in VEGF expression. There was also no correlation between macrophage amount and VEGF expression. Conclusion: Ethanolic extract of Moringa oleifera leaves extract proved to be effective in decreasing macrophage cell count on Wistar rats with burn wounds.
The Effect of Ethanolic Extract from Moringa oleifera Leaves in Collagen Density and Numbers of New Capillary Vessel Count on Wistar Rats Burn Wound Supandi Andy; Najatullah; Nugroho Trilaksana; Neni Susilaningsih

Abstract

Background: Burns are a major cause of morbidity, including prolonged length of stay and disability, which requires no small amount of treatment costs. Currently, there are many studies to accelerate the healing of wounds, one of which is with Moringa oleifera (MO). This study aimed to prove the effect of ethanolic extract from MO leaves on collagen density and new capillary vessel count on Wistar rats' burn wounds. Methods: This research is randomized post-test only with a control group design. Twenty-four male Wistar rats induced burn wounds and were randomly divided into 4 groups which were given topical medicine once daily for 10 days; P1 (MO leaves extract 10%), P2 (Silver Sulfadiazine + MO leaves extract 10%), P3 (SSD), and P4 (negative control). Collagen density was assessed using the Kruskal-Wallis test and continued with Mann-Whitney Test. New capillary vessel count was assessed using Hematoxylin-Eosin staining and One Way ANOVA. The correlation test between two variables was tested using the Spearman test. Results: Collagen Density shows significant difference in group P1 compared to P4 (p=0,016), group P2 compared to P3 (p=0,047), group P2 compared to P4 (p=0,009). A significant increase in new capillary blood vessel counts was seen in group P1 compared to P3 and P4 (p=0.001; 0,000) and group P2 compared to P3 and P4 (p=0,000;0,000). A positive correlation was found between the new capillary blood vessel count and epithelization percentage (p=0,001), with a strong correlation (rho=0,682). Conclusion: Ethanolic extract from Moringa oleifera leaves proved to be effective in increasing collagen density and new capillary vessel count.
EFEK DLBS1425 TOPIKAL BERBAGAI KONSENTRASI TERHADAP EKSPRESI COX-2 KORNEA TIKUS WISTAR PASCA TRAUMA BASA Satya Hutama Pragnanda; Trilaksana Nugroho; Sri Inakawati

Abstract

Latar Belakang: Trauma kimia pada permukaan bola mata merupakan masalah umum dengan derajat yang berbeda mulai ringan sampai berat. Trauma basa kuat meningkatkan pH jaringan, sehingga ion hidroksida (OH-) penetrasi pada jaringan epitel kornea menyebabkan saponifikasi membran sel dan hidrolisis jaringan. Cyclooxygenase-2 (COX-2) merupakan enzim yang penting dalam sintesis prekursor mediator inflamasi. Obat anti inflamasi steroid dapat menghambat hal ini, sehingga memiliki efek anti inflamasi yang poten, namun memiliki banyak efek samping. Phaleriamacrocarpa adalah tanaman obat asli Indonesia yang memiliki efek anti inflamasi. DLBS1425 merupakan sediaan farmasi ekstrak Phaleriamacrocarpa yang memiliki efek anti inflamasi. Peneliti ingin mengetahui efek anti inflamasi DLBS1425 di bidang mata, dinilai dari ekspresi COX-2 kornea tikus Wistar pasca trauma basa.Tujuan: Membuktikan DLBS1425 topikal berbagai konsentrasi memiliki efek terhadap ekspresi COX-2 kornea tikus Wistar pasca trauma basa.Metode: Merupakan penelitian post-test only randomized controlled group design. 24 mata tikus Wistar mendapat paparan NaOH 1M, dibagi menjadi 4 kelompok. Kelompok K diberi tetes Hyalub, sedangkan P1, P2, dan P3 diberi tetes DLBS1425 konsentrasi 1x101mg/ml, 1x100mg/ml,dan1x10-1mg/ml. Setelah 7 hari, dinilai ekspresi COX-2 kornea secara imunohistokimia. Analisis statistik menggunakan uji Kruskal Wallis dan Mann Whitney.Hasil: Rerata ekspresi COX-2 kelompok K=4,86, P1=3,30, P2=3,73, dan P3=4,13. Terdapat penurunan pada semua kelompok perlakuan,dibanding kontrol, dimana P1 berbeda signifikan secara statistik (p=0,015).Kesimpulan: DLBS1425 topikal konsentrasi 1x101mg/ml memiliki efek penurunan ekspresi COX-2 kornea tikus Wistar pasca trauma basa dibanding kontrol. Kata kunci: Trauma basa, inflamasi kornea, DLBS1425, COX-2
INHIBISI FRAKSI BIOAKTIF MAHKOTA DEWA (PHALERIA MACROCARPA) TOPIKAL TERHADAP EKSPRESI VEGF KORNEA TIKUS WISTAR PASCA TRAUMA BASA Mandasari Mandarana; Trilaksana Nugroho; Sri Inakawati

Abstract

Latar Belakang: Kornea merupakan jaringan mata yang bersifat transparan dan avaskuler, sifat tersebut diperlukan dalam fungsi penglihatan normal, dipertahankan oleh keseimbangan faktor angiogenik dan antiangiogenik. Vascular Endothelial Growth Factor (VEGF) berperan dalam angiogenesis, terdapat peningkatan ekspresi VEGF pada neovaskularisasi kornea. Penelitian sebelumnya menunjukkan bahwa fraksi bioaktif Mahkota Dewa (Phaleria macrocarpa), DLBS1425, memiliki efek antiangiogenesis dengan cara menghambat ekspresi mRNA VEGF-C pada sel kanker payudara. Penelitian ini ingin mengetahui efek antiangiogenesis DLBS1425 di bidang mata, dinilai dari ekspresi VEGF kornea tikus Wistar pasca trauma.Tujuan: Membuktikan DLBS1425 topikal berbagai konsentrasi memiliki efek terhadap ekspresi VEGF kornea tikus Wistar pasca trauma basa.Metode: Penelitian ini merupakan true experimental post-test only design. Dua puluh empat ekor tikus Wistar mendapat paparan NaOH 1M dengan diameter 1 mm, dibagi secara acak menjadi 4 kelompok. Kelompok K diberi tetes Hyalub, kelompok P1 diberi tetes DLBS1425 konsentrasi 1 x 101 mg/ml, kelompok P2 diberi tetes DLBS1425 konsentrasi 1 x 100 mg/ml, kelompok P3 diberi tetes DLBS1425 konsentrasi 1 x 10-1 mg/ml. Setelah 7 hari, dinilai ekspresi VEGF kornea secara imunohistokimia. Analisis statistik menggunakan uji Kruskal Wallis.Hasil Penelitian: Rerata ekspresi VEGF pada kelompok K=4,93, kelompok P1=4,33, kelompok P2=4,47, kelompok P3=4,77. Ekspresi VEGF kelompok perlakuan lebih rendah dibandingkan kelompok kontrol (p=0,134).Kesimpulan: DLBS1425 topikal konsentrasi 1x10-1, 1x100 dan 1x101 memiliki efek terhadap ekspresi VEFG kornea tikus Wistar pasca trauma basa. Ekspresi VEGF pada kelompok perlakuan lebih rendah dibandingkan dengan kelompok kontrol. Kata kunci: Phaleria macrocarpa, DLBS1425, VEGF, neovaskularisasi kornea

Toxic Effect of Topical DLBS1425 Towards Proliferation Degree and Mucin Secretion in Rabbit’s Eye Amy Aurelian; Trilaksana Nugroho; Dina Novita

Abstract

Background: Phaleria macrocarpa (DLBS1425) is a medicinal plant that has the effects of anti-cancer, anti-inflammation, anti-angiogenesis, and antioxidants. The potency of its toxicity is low towards normal cell. DLBS1425 is expected to be useable for eye drop, but its toxic effect towards goblet cell proliferation and mucin secretion still remain unknown.Methods: This is experimental study with design of comparison test. Twenty four rabbits’ eyes divided into 4 groups were given placebo and topical DLBS1425 with concentration of 1×10-1 mg/ml, 1×100 mg/ml, and 1×101 mg/ml. Goblet cell proliferation degree and mucin secretion were evaluated using histopathology examination from rabits’ conjunctiva.Results: In the group of goblet cell proliferation, compared to control group, there was decreased proliferation degree with topical DLBS1425 of 1×10-1 mg/ml; but the concentration of 1×100 mg/ml and 1×101 mg/ml did not affect goblet cell proliferation. In the group of mucin secretion, DLBS1425 with any concentration level decreased mucin secretion significantly.Conclusion: There was significant difference in goblet cell proliferation with topical DLBS1425 of 1×10-1 mg/ml and placebo. There was also significant difference in mucin secretion with topical DLBS1425 in any concentration level and placebo. Keywords: DLBS1425, goblet cell, mucin secretion
